Emma Canter (of Mind Values Leadership) will then present her thoughts on how we can continue getting better at what we do, sharing insights from supervision, coaching and reflection.

In particular we’ll explore the concept of supervision within the people profession - as a supportive process where you can reflect on your practice in a safe, psychological space. It provides opportunities to gain objectivity, explore difficult situations and ethical issues, and support self-awareness and self-care.

About the speaker

Emma Canter

Emma Canter is an experienced leadership development consultant, facilitator, and coach. She is based locally and established Mind Values Leadership in 2019. Her background is firmly rooted in HR and people management, having worked at a senior level in the UK and North America.

In 2016, Emma took her own brave next step to leave the corporate world and start her own leadership development business. This was rebranded to Mind Values Leadership to reflect the values that guide her work: transparency, authenticity, and a commitment to leading from the heart.
